About This Position

The Office Administrator will play a key role in ensuring smooth office operations by assisting with accounting tasks, maintaining records, and supporting HR-related functions. This role will handle a variety of administrative duties including financial document processing, managing HR records, assisting with payroll, employee onboarding, and providing general office support.

  • Serves as the receptionist for the office, greeting visitors and applicants.
  • Assist with data entry for accounts payable/receivable and monthly reconciliation.
  • Assist with the management of invoices, receipts, purchase orders, and other financial records.
  • Assist with employees onboarding, including processing new hire paperwork, conducting orientations, and ensuring compliance with company policies.
  • Sort incoming mail and deliver to the appropriate department or individuals, processes outgoing mail.
  • Maintain office organization by ordering supplies, managing equipment, and ensuring that the workspace is well-maintained.
  • Maintains the integrity and confidentiality of human resource files and records.
  • Assists with planning and execution of special events such as benefits enrollment, organization-wide meetings, and holiday parties.
  • Assist with special projects and other tasks as assigned by senior leadership or management.
  • Duties and responsibilities may change, and new ones may be added at any time with or without advanced notice.

Required Skills/Abilities:

  • High school diploma or equivalent; associate or bachelor’s degree in accounting, business, human resources, or a related field preferred.
  • 1–3 years of experience in office administration, accounting, HR support, or executive assistance.
  • Experience with payroll, HR software, or recruitment is a plus.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, Outlook).
  • Analytical abilities and aptitude in problem-solving
  • Strong attention to detail and high level of accuracy.
  • Ability to handle sensitive and confidential information with discretion.

Physical Requirements:

  • Prolonged periods sitting at a desk and working on a computer.
  • Must be able to lift to 15 pounds at times.
